Abstract :
An existing stable multi-rate sampled output feedback linear controller design method for linear systems is extended to nonlinear systems. General output feedback nonlinear controller design methods for nonlinear systems with perturbation are investigated too. Stabilizability and robustness conditions for such nonlinear multi-rate sampled output feedback control systems are derived.
